codeWithYoha logo
Code with Yoha
HomeAboutContact
ChatGPT

Integrating ChatGPT and LLMs into Backend Automation Workflows

CodeWithYoha
CodeWithYoha
3 min read
Integrating ChatGPT and LLMs into Backend Automation Workflows

Introduction

Integrating ChatGPT and other large language models (LLMs) into backend workflows offers significant improvements in automation and efficiency. By leveraging these AI technologies, developers can create smarter applications that streamline operations and enhance user experiences.

Understanding LLMs and ChatGPT

Large Language Models (LLMs) like ChatGPT are AI systems designed to understand and generate human-like text based on input prompts. These models are trained on diverse datasets, enabling them to perform various tasks such as content generation, data summarization, and even complex decision-making processes. ChatGPT, a variant of GPT developed by OpenAI, is tailored for conversational applications but can be adapted for backend processes.

Benefits of Integrating LLMs

Integrating LLMs into backend workflows provides numerous benefits:

  • Efficiency: Automate repetitive tasks, reducing the need for manual intervention.
  • Scalability: Handle large volumes of requests without compromising performance.
  • Intelligence: Enhance decision-making processes with AI-driven insights and recommendations.

Setting Up ChatGPT for Backend Integration

To integrate ChatGPT into your backend, you need to:

  1. API Access: Obtain API access from OpenAI to use ChatGPT in your applications.
  2. Environment Setup: Configure your development environment with necessary libraries and dependencies.
  3. Authentication: Implement secure authentication mechanisms to protect your API keys.

Here's a basic example in Python:

import openai

openai.api_key = 'your-api-key'

response = openai.Completion.create(
  model="text-davinci-003",
  prompt="Summarize the recent meeting notes",
  max_tokens=150
)

print(response['choices'][0]['text'])

Automating Processes with ChatGPT

LLMs can be used to automate numerous backend processes:

  • Customer Support: Automate responses to common queries using AI-generated answers.
  • Data Analysis: Summarize and analyze large datasets, providing insights and trends.
  • Content Generation: Automatically generate reports, emails, and other textual content.

Challenges and Considerations

While integrating LLMs offers many advantages, there are challenges to consider:

  • Cost: Usage of LLMs can be costly, especially at scale.
  • Latency: Response times may vary based on model size and complexity.
  • Ethical Considerations: Ensure that AI-generated content aligns with ethical guidelines and company policies.

Future of LLMs in Backend Workflows

The future of LLMs in backend workflows is promising. As models become more efficient and cost-effective, their applications will expand across industries. Continuous advancements in AI will lead to even more intelligent and autonomous systems.

Conclusion

Integrating ChatGPT and other LLMs into backend workflows can significantly enhance automation and intelligence. By understanding the potential of these technologies and addressing their challenges, developers can create robust, efficient systems that transform how businesses operate. As AI technology continues to evolve, the integration of LLMs will play a crucial role in shaping the future of backend development.